Database Engineer- SQL Server
Role details
Job location
Tech stack
Job description
This role is ideal for an engineer who enjoys owning production database environments, solving real-time issues, and improving system stability through automation, observability, and proactive performance optimization. You will play a key role in ensuring databases are highly available, resilient, and operating at scale-rather than building analytics platforms or data pipelines.
You'll work both independently and collaboratively to deliver database improvements, troubleshoot complex issues, and support critical production systems, while applying best practices in SQL Server administration, automation, and reliability engineering. The Work Itself:
Production Database Ownership (SRE Focus)
Own the health, stability, and reliability of SQL Server production environments. Continuously improve availability, monitoring, alerting, and incident response practices.
Performance Tuning and Reliability
Diagnose and resolve real-world production issues including slow queries, blocking, deadlocks, and resource contention. Optimize performance through advanced T-SQL tuning, indexing strategies, and execution plan analysis.
Monitoring, Alerting, and Incident Response
Build and maintain monitoring and alerting systems for database health and performance. Participate in on-call rotations, triaging and resolving incidents to minimize downtime and business impact.
Backup, Recovery, and High Availability
Own backup/restore processes, disaster recovery planning, and HA solutions (Always On, replication). Ensure systems are resilient and meet uptime expectations.
Automation and Operational Efficiency
Develop and maintain automation using PowerShell and SQL Server tooling (SQL Agent jobs, scripting, etc.) to streamline operations and reduce manual intervention.
Security and Compliance
Manage database access, permissions, and security configurations. Ensure adherence to data protection and operational security best practices.
Collaboration with Engineering Teams
Work closely with application engineers to support production database usage, improve query efficiency, and troubleshoot issues in real time.
This is a hybrid position.Expectationofdays intheoffice will be confirmed by your Hiring Manager.This role requires 24/7oncallproduction support.This role is not eligible for employment-based visa sponsorship. Candidates must be authorized to work in the United States without current or future sponsorship. Visa requires at least 3 days in office, expectations of these days will be confirmed by your Hiring Manager.
Requirements
We are seeking a SQL Server Database Engineer with a strong focus on production operations and reliability engineering (SRE).
As part of this team, you will contribute to the plan, build, and run of Microsoft SQL Server database infrastructure, with a primary focus on system reliability, performance, and operational excellence.
This is a hands-on Microsoft SQL Server role requiring strong T-SQL and PowerShell skills, with an emphasis on production support, automation, and performance tuning., * 2+ years of relevant work experience and a Bachelors degree, OR 5+ years of relevant work experience Preferred Qualifications
- 2-5 years of hands-on experience with Microsoft SQL Server in production environments
- Strong experience with:
- T-SQL (query tuning, stored procedures, performance troubleshooting)
- PowerShell scripting for automation and operational tasks
- SQL Server performance tuning (indexing, execution plans)
- Experience supporting production systems or on-call environments
- Experience with backup/recovery and database maintenance
- Strong problem-solving skills in live operational scenarios
Nice to Have
- Experience with automation platforms (e.g., Ansible)
- Observability experience (Clickhouse, Grafana, Prometheus, Datadog, etc.)
- Exposure to SQL Server HA/DR (Always On, replication, clustering)
- Experience in SRE, DevOps, or operations-focused roles
- Cloud exposure (AWS or GCP)
- Familiarity with Git/GitHub
- Experience leveraging AI/code assistant tools for troubleshooting or automation
Benefits & conditions
The estimated salary range for this positionis $110,700.00 to $ 171,800.00 USD per year, which may include potential sales incentive payments (if applicable). Salary may vary depending on job-related factors which may include knowledge, skills, experience, and location. In addition, this position may be eligible for bonus and equity.Visa has a comprehensive benefits package for which this position may be eligible that includes Medical, Dental, Vision, 401(k), FSA/HSA, Life Insurance, Paid Time Off, and Wellness Program.